Service Description

Increased customer expectations, safety requirements, statutory requirements as well as the increased use of electronic components and software lead to more complex products. End customer expectations can no longer only be determined in specifications. Automotive manufacturers and the supplier industry must identify these product characteristics independently and transfer them into the products. This focus must also be taken into account when conducting product audits. Meanwhile, product quality is assured by consistent implementation of preventive quality planning methods. For this reason, product audits have the task of not only assuring quality but also providing evidence. Within the process chain, product audits are expected to highlight the quality level of the internally/externally manufactured products.
